ING Groep NV purchased a new stake in D.R. Horton, Inc. (NYSE:DHI - Free Report) in the 1st quarter, according to its most recent filing with the SEC. The institutional investor purchased 68,722 shares of the construction company's stock, valued at approximately $8,737,000.

D.R. Horton (NYSE:DHI -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Tuesday, July 22nd. The construction company reported $3.36 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$2.90 by $0.46. D.R. Horton had a net margin of 11.46% and a return on equity of 15.74%. The firm had revenue of $9.23 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$8.80 billion. During the same period in the prior year, the firm earned $4.10 EPS. The company's revenue was down 7.4% compared to the same quarter last year. As a group, analysts forecast that D.R. Horton, Inc. will post 13.04 EPS for the current year.

D.R. Horton Announces Dividend

The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, August 14th. Shareholders of record on Thursday, August 7th will be issued a dividend of $0.40 per share. This represents a $1.60 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 1.0%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Thursday, August 7th. D.R. Horton's dividend payout ratio is currently 12.83%.
